Redbud Seedlings - Cercis Canadensis

Redbud Seedlings are small deciduous trees native to eastern North America, prized for their clusters of pink to lavender flowers that bloom on bare branches in early spring before their heart-shaped leaves emerge.

They are prized for their ornamental qualities and offer many landscaping benefits. These young trees, known for their vibrant blossoms and distinctive heart-shaped leaves, bring aesthetic, ecological, and functional advantages to outdoor spaces.

Redbud Seedlings (Cercis Canadensis) Growth

Once you put a sapling in the ground, you can expect it to grow relatively quickly. You must have plenty of room for the roots to grow, as the tree does not respond well to being moved after the fact. However, the root system can provide a solid anchor if you're on a slope or near a body of water.

As Redbud Seedlings grow, they will become home to several bird species and other animals that eat the seeds the tree produces. Of course, you can also use the seeds the tree drops to grow the size of your forest or garden landscape. In some cases, birds or other animals that eat the seeds will also transport them throughout your property, where they can propagate independently.

Redbud Seedlings are easy to plant and take little maintenance after being put in the ground. However, they can be susceptible to pest damage as they sprout and grow. Therefore, you'll want to make sure that you take proper precautions to keep your seedlings healthy. On average, this plant will last for about 30 years, so you'll have it for most of your life if cared for properly.

How tall do redbud trees get?

Redbud trees typically grow 20 to 30 feet tall with a rounded, spreading canopy. They’re known for their beautiful pink blooms that appear in early spring. With sunlight and well-drained soil, they grow quickly and stay elegant year after year.

Is redbud a good front yard tree?

Yes, Redbud is a perfect front yard tree. It stays small, grows quickly, and fills spring with bright pink blooms. Its heart-shaped leaves and compact size make it both beautiful and easy to maintain.

Is a red bud tree messy?

No, Redbud trees are not messy. They stay neat while offering stunning flowers in spring and lush foliage through summer. Their tidy growth and manageable size make them an excellent choice for any yard.

How To Grow
Care Tips
Redbud seedlings thrive in well-draining soil with regular watering, especially during dry periods. Fertilize in early spring. Trim to keep form and clear any damaged or crossing limbs. Keep them weed-free to ensure healthy growth.
